Greene Villa MHP PWS is one of 1,399 community water systems in Ohio in the 500 or fewer people size category, formerly serving 40 people from groundwater.

EPA's federal records list this system as inactive in 2005; the record below is historical.

As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 20 entries between 1989 and 2003, all of which EPA lists as closed. Nothing has been added since 2003.

Of the 20, 19 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ves inorganic chemicals, the Total Coliform Rules, and the Consumer Confidence Rule.
